Thanks fayden,
So based on this, does that mean that Frost Nova will NOT cause this talent to trigger?
Correct. If you don't already have a slow on the target before you drop a shatter bomb, your frostbolt will not get the 12% bonus. This is why when I duel mages I usually let my MI put a frostbolt on them, and then frost nova>IL>DF, then Silence into a shatter bomb from my water elemental, to get full benefit on my burst opportunities.

Most probably know this but for thos who dont, you don't need to slow the target yourselfl ever in PvE. All tanks have abilities that slow an enemy. Even abilities which slow casting speed are considered a slowing effect. I always check to make sure they are using them because some fail tanks don't. This should equate to an automatic dps boost.
Does the spell slow work even if the target doesn't use spells?
All tanks have an ability that slows an enemy's attack speed, not necessarily snare. A Warrior's Thunder Clap snares, a Paladin's Judgements of the Just doesn't.

Slow doesn't work on most bosses, but yes, against mobs/players, you benefit from TTW with Slow applied.
Also, Thunderclap doesn't snare, unless there's some mysterious protection talent that I don't know about.

And just to clarify, sorry for my unclear wording, I meant abilities that slow casting speeds, as opposed to Slow, the spell.
Having said that, if it does work with Thunder Clap and Judgements of the Just, then it implies that TTW also works with abilities that decrease melee attack speed, as well as casting speed.

FWIW, Slow does work on Raid bosses, just not the movement speed part. The Casting and Ranged Attack snare does stick, and thus, causes TTW to activate.
